當前位置:首頁 » 編程語言 » c語言記賬軟體
擴展閱讀
webinf下怎麼引入js 2023-08-31 21:54:13
堡壘機怎麼打開web 2023-08-31 21:54:11

c語言記賬軟體

發布時間: 2022-08-24 16:08:22

『壹』 一百分懸賞!數據結構課程設計--用c語言寫一個記賬本程序

什麼時候要 ?、
但是還是要自己動手的好 不過要是過個月的話我還能試試
希望自己能解決 加油 相信自己
真的想就聯系我 不過我要打寒假工 有點困難 時間的久點

『貳』 最全面的記賬軟體

最全面的記賬軟體就是moneywise軟體。國內用戶數最多的理財軟體。
它聯網,但不把數據上傳,這考慮隱私性以及網路不穩定性因素設置的。它的補助方法:手機版或網路版記賬,數據同步到本地電腦中。
http://www..com/?wd=%B9%FA%C4%DA%D3%C3%BB%A7%CA%FD%D7%EE%B6%E0%B5%C4%C0%ED%B2%C6%C8%ED%BC%

『叄』 僅用c++能開發出一個簡單的軟體嗎急!!希望能聽到具體的回答,如果不能,我需要准備其他的什麼謝謝!

可以,不過你要知道硬體結構,不知道你學過單片機沒有,我用單片機做可視化界面設計的時候,界面的菜單都是用C語言寫的。
C++ 也是一樣的,其實歸根到底,他所集成的那些庫函數都是用C/C++寫的。這些庫都已經封裝好了,為的就是怕你知道底層硬體結構。

『肆』 能夠運行c語言的軟體有哪些

C語言是一門歷史很長的編程語言,其編譯器和開發工具也多種多樣,其開發工具包括編譯器,現舉幾個開發工具供大家選擇,當然也要根據自己的操作系統來選擇適合自己的開發工具。

好多剛開始接觸c語言的朋友都想知道用上面軟體開發c語言比較好,一般來說微軟的東西肯定是最好的,更適合新手學習,等上手了就可以接觸別的軟體了。

Microsoft Visual C++ 、Microsoft Visual Studio、 DEV C++、Code::Blocks、Borland C++、WaTCom C++、Borland C++ Builder、GNU DJGPP C++、Lccwin32 C Compiler3.1、High C、Turb C、gcc、C-Free和Win-TC、My Tc等等,太多了,由於C語言比較成熟,所以編程環境很多。建議使用Microsoft Visual C++。

在Windows下做軟體開發,編譯器的首選當然是Visual Studio,目前微軟也有免費的Microsoft Visual C++2008Express版本可供下載和使用。但是,如果考慮做跨平台的軟體,選擇gcc作為編譯器無疑是明智的,無論Linux,MacOSX還是其他的Unix變體,大多選用gcc作為編譯器,所以,選擇gcc作為編譯器能夠讓你的軟體提前通過編譯器的驗證,能夠更容易的在不同平台上通過編譯。TDM GCC項目已經幫助大家測試並整合了Windows平台下的gcc安裝工具TDM GCC On-Demand Installer,大家可以根據需要選擇下載並安裝那些工具包。安裝完成後,需要修改環境變數,將安裝目錄加入PATH搜索路徑中。

1、TC 2.0:Borland公司的產品,在dos界面下編譯運行,小巧、靈活,但是不能使用滑鼠,界面如下:

菜單命令是alt+菜單項的第一個字母,可以調試,在第一次用的時候,可以需要配置一下目錄,如下:

第一次使用可能感覺不舒服(滑鼠不能用的緣故),慢慢熟悉一段時間,就沒事了,當初在學校學習考試都是這個環境。

2、win-TC:在tc2.0的基礎上加上了界面,能夠使用滑鼠,具有語法高亮,可以嵌入匯編等特點,對新手一些,拜託了不能用滑鼠的困難。編寫完源代碼,進行編譯運行即可,軟體比較容易上手。

3、dev-C++:是windows下一款開發c/c++的開發環境,使用gcc為編譯器,遵循標准,功能比較強大,語法高亮,可以進行單步調試(這對排除錯誤很重要),進行斷點設置等功能,遵循C標准,是一款很強大的開發工具。

4、VC++,微軟的產品,編譯器,鏈接器,運行,調試等功能於一體的強大開發工具,特點是功能十分強大,對於新手來說需要一段時間去摸索

c語言編程軟體(支持win7/win8)是一款支持多語言開發的開發系統。c語言編程軟體(支持win7/win8)同時支持c語言,c++以及vb語言的開發,軟體能很好的兼容win7以及win8,用戶只需設置軟體兼容性,把它設為win 98,win xp等等。

為大家提供的c語言編程軟體為vc++6.0。VC++6.0是Microsoft公司推出的一個基於Windows系統平台、可視化的集成開發環境,它的源程序按C++語言的要求編寫,並加入了微軟提供的功能強大的MFC(Microsoft Foundation Class)類庫。

c語言編程軟體(支持win7/win8)的MFC類庫中封裝了大部分Windows API函數和Windows控制項,它包含的功能涉及到整個Windows操作系統。MFC不僅給用戶提供了Windows圖形環境下應用程序的框架,而且還提供了創建應用程序的組件,這樣,開發人員不必從頭設計創建和管理一個標准Windows應用程序所需的程序,而是從一個比較高的起點編程,故節省了大量的時間。另外,它提供了大量的代碼,指導用戶編程時實現某些技術和功能。因此,使用VC++提供的高度可視化的應用程序開發工具和MFC類庫,可使應用程序開發變得簡單。

『伍』 c語言用什麼軟體編寫

可以編寫c語言的軟體有:Vim、C++編譯器、Dev-C++、Code::Blocks、Visual Studio等。

1、Vim

Vim是一個類似於Vi的著名的功能強大、高度可定製的文本編輯器,在Vi的基礎上改進和增加了很多特性。VIM是自由軟體。Vim普遍被推崇為類Vi編輯器中最好的一個,事實上真正的勁敵來自Emacs的不同變體。

1999 年Emacs被選為Linuxworld文本編輯分類的優勝者,Vim屈居第二。但在2000年2月Vim贏得了Slashdot Beanie的最佳開放源代碼文本編輯器大獎,又將Emacs推至二線, 總的來看, Vim和Emacs在文本編輯方面都是非常優秀的。

『陸』 推薦幾個C語言編程軟體

基礎的書上一般都是以TC2.0寫的,你可以下載一個,或者用可視化的VC++6.0這個程序比較大,網上好多下載的地方的,書我可以發給你譚浩強的C語言程序設計第三版。要的話我發給你

『柒』 高分懸賞c語言大學生記賬程序的實現,急急急!!!在線等~~~

#include <stdio.h>
#include <stdlib.h>

typedef struct moneydata
{
double n;
struct moneydata* next;
}NUM;

//main
int main()
{
NUM* initial();
NUM* build(NUM* money);
void input(NUM* income,NUM* payment);
void output(NUM* income,NUM* payment);
double incomeSum(NUM* income);
double paymentSum(NUM* income);

double toplimit;
double SUM;
char ch;
NUM *income,*payment;
printf("enter your payment toplimit\n");
scanf("%lf",&toplimit);
fflush(stdin);
printf("*************************************************\n\n");
income=initial();
payment=initial();

for(;;)
{
printf("please choose what you want to do\n");
printf("1.input 2.analyse 3.quit\n");
scanf("%c",&ch);
fflush(stdin);
printf("*************************************************\n\n");
switch(ch)
{
//輸入函數,對收入和支出的輸入處理
case '1':
input(income,payment);
printf("*************************************************\n\n");
break;
//數據分析,包括輸出收入總和,支出總和,對收入支出比較,輸出利潤和提醒是否要存錢了
case '2':
printf("please choose what you want to do\n");
printf("1.output income's sum 2.output payment's sum 3.compare with toplimit\n");
scanf("%c",&ch);
fflush(stdin);
switch(ch)
{
case '1':
SUM=incomeSum(income);
printf("%f\n",SUM);
break;
case '2':
SUM=paymentSum(payment);
printf("%f\n",SUM);
break;
case '3':
double profit;
SUM=incomeSum(income);
profit=SUM;
printf("your income's sum is:");
printf("%f\n",SUM);
SUM=paymentSum(payment);
printf("your payment's sum is:");
printf("%f\n",SUM);

profit=profit - SUM;
printf("your profit is:");
printf("%f\n",profit);
if(profit<=0)
{
printf("you shoule save money!!\n");
}
else
{
printf("you can spend your money as you like\n");
}
break;
}
printf("*************************************************\n\n");
break;
case '3':
system("pause");
exit(0);
}
}
return 0;
}

//table initial
//鏈表初始化
NUM* initial()
{
NUM* money;
money=(NUM*)malloc(sizeof(NUM));
money->n=0;
money->next=money;
return money;
}

//build
//鏈表擴展
NUM* build(NUM* money)
{
NUM* temp;
temp=(NUM*)malloc(sizeof(NUM));
temp->n=0;
money->next=temp;
temp->next=money;
return temp;
}

//input
//數據輸入
void input(NUM* income,NUM* payment)
{
NUM* build(NUM* money);
printf("please choose what you want to enter:\n");
printf("1.income 2.payment\n");

char ch;
NUM* temp1,*temp2;
scanf("%c",&ch);
fflush(stdin);
temp1=income;
temp2=payment;

switch(ch)
{
case '1':
printf("please enter your income today:\n");
temp1=build(temp1);
scanf("%lf",&temp1->n);
fflush(stdin);
break;
case '2':
printf("please enter your payment today:\n");
temp2=build(temp2);
scanf("%lf",&temp2->n);
fflush(stdin);
break;
default :printf("enter ERROR!\n");
return ;
}
}

//output
//數據輸出
void output(NUM* income,NUM* payment)
{
printf("please choose what you want to do\n");
printf("1.output all income 2.output all payment\n");

char ch;
NUM *temp1,*temp2;
scanf("%c",&ch);
temp1=income;
temp2=payment;

switch(ch)
{
case '1':
for(;temp1!=income;temp1=temp1->next)
{
printf("%f",temp1->n);
}
break;
case '2':
for(;temp2!=payment;temp2=temp2->next)
{
printf(" %f",temp2->n);
}
break;
default :printf("output ERROR!\n");
}
printf("\n");
}

//income calculate
//收入計算(收入和支出在不同的鏈表中,同時處理要返回兩個值,這不可能)
//可以用引用,但引用是C++裡面有的,樓主要求是C,所以就不用引用了,而且引用一般出錯率很高
double incomeSum(NUM* income)
{
double sum;
NUM* temp;
temp=income->next;
sum=0;

for(;temp!=income;temp=temp->next)
{
sum=sum + temp->n;
}
return sum;
}

//payment calculate
//支出計算
double paymentSum(NUM* payment)
{
double sum;
NUM* temp;
temp=payment->next;
sum=0;

for(;temp!=payment;temp=temp->next)
{
sum=sum + temp->n;
}
return sum;
}

還有啥不明白的地方可以問我,寫個程序不容易啊親,滿意請採納,程序本身是不難寫的,只是有點麻煩……
這個程序只能做到對數據的錄入和輸出,比較收入支出的大小,想要其它功能再說吧。

『捌』 常用的c語言編程軟體有哪些

Microsoft
Visual
C++
、Microsoft
Visual
Studio、
DEV
C++、Code::Blocks、Borland
C++、WaTCom
C++、Borland
C++
Builder、GNU
DJGPP
C++、Lccwin32
C
Compiler3.1、High
C、Turb
C、gcc、C-Free和Win-TC、My
Tc等等,太多了,由於C語言比較成熟,所以編程環境很多。初學者推薦用DEV
C++、C-Free或者Code::Blocks,因為它們功能都比較強大,又免費,同時安裝包也不大。

『玖』 c語言編程軟體有哪些

Windows平台下主要用Visual Studio、還有Dev C++、CodeBlockers等
Linux平台下主要用gcc

『拾』 C語言編程有哪些好用的軟體

1.C語言編程軟體有哪些。
Mcrosoft Visual C++ 、Microsoft Visual Studio、 DEV C++、Code::Blocks、Borland C++、WaTCom C++、Borland C++ Builder、GNU DJGPP C++、Lccwin32 C Compiler3.1、High C、Turb C、gcc、C-Free和Win-TC、My Tc等等,由於C語言比較成熟,所以編程環境很多。

2.C語言入門,不推薦使用VC,因為VC不但龐大,而且應用開發比較高級。入門編程薦使用Dev-C 和 WIN-TC。
1)WIN-TC,該軟體使用TC2為內核,提供WINDOWS平台的開發界面,因此也就支持WINDOWS平台下的功能,例如剪切、復制、粘貼和查找替換等。而且在功能上也有它的獨特特色例如語法加亮、C內嵌匯編、自定義擴展庫的支持等。並提供一組相關輔助工具令你在編程過程中更加游刃有餘。
2)Dev-C ,Dev-C 是一個Windows下的C和C 程序的集成開發環境。它使用MingW32/GCC編譯器,遵循C/C 標准。開發環境包括多頁面窗口、工程編輯器以及調試器等,在工程編輯器中集合了編輯器、編譯器、連接程序和執行程序,提供高亮度語法顯示的,以減少編輯錯誤,還有完善的調試功能,能夠適合初學者與編程高手的不同需求,是學習C或C的首選開發工具。